The red wine Vignànima Carmenère Colli Euganei DOC, vintage 2017 from the winery Il Mottolo has been rated in 2020 by Kiem Othmar, Staffler Simon with 88 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Carmenère from the region Veneto in Italy.

Tasting Notes

88
Tasting from 15.06.2020: Kiem Othmar, Staffler Simon

Deep, rich crimson garnet in colour. Noticeable oak on the nose, slightly dusty and chalky, with very ripe berry fruit, and dark chocolate. Dense and full on the palate, with plenty of substance, but is completely countered by the wood, which is inhibiting and drying.
